Partou UK in Ellesmere Port is seeking a Nursery Deputy Manager for a full-time role with a salary of £30,284 plus a £1,000 Welcome Bonus. The ideal candidate will support the Nursery Manager in ensuring children engage in stimulating activities aligned with the Early Years Foundation Stage and lead a passionate team.

Benefits include:

  • Childcare discount
  • Enhanced maternity and paternity leave
  • Access to professional development training

How to prepare for a job interview at Partou UK

Know Your Early Years Foundations

Make sure you brush up on the Early Years Foundation Stage (EYFS) framework. Be ready to discuss how you can implement stimulating activities that align with it, as this will show your understanding of the role and your commitment to early education.

Showcase Your Leadership Skills

As a Nursery Deputy Manager, you'll be leading a team. Prepare examples of how you've successfully managed or supported a team in the past. Highlight your ability to motivate others and create a positive environment for both staff and children.

Prepare Questions About Professional Development

Partou UK values professional growth, so come prepared with questions about training opportunities and career progression. This shows your eagerness to develop and your long-term interest in the role.

Emphasise Your Passion for Childcare

During the interview, let your passion for early education shine through. Share personal anecdotes or experiences that highlight why you love working with children and how you can make a positive impact in their lives.
